区块链,作为一种分布式数据存储、点对点传输、共识机制、加密算法等计算机技术的新型应用模式,其记录能力广泛而强大,从本质上讲,区块链是一个共享数据库,能够记录的信息种类繁多,包括但不限于以下几个方面:

一、交易信息

区块链的核心功能之一是记录交易信息,在数字货币领域,如比特币,区块链记录了每一笔交易的转出方、收入方、金额及转出方的数字签名等详细信息,这些交易信息被永久地存储在区块链上,无法被篡改或删除,从而确保了交易的透明度和可信度。

(图片来源网络,侵删)

二、身份和权属信息

区块链还可以记录身份和权属信息,在数字身份认证方面,区块链技术可以确保个人身份信息的安全和隐私,防止身份盗用和信息泄露,区块链还可以用于记录所有权契据、学位证、结婚证等权属信息,这些信息的记录和验证都通过区块链的分布式账本实现,无需依赖中心化的第三方机构。

三、公共管理和服务信息

区块链技术在公共管理领域的应用也逐渐增多,政府可以利用区块链技术来存储和验证选举投票、政府文件存档等信息,提高公共管理的透明度和可信度,区块链还可以应用于医疗记录、食品安全追溯等领域,确保信息的真实性和可追溯性。

(图片来源网络,侵删)

四、合约和智能合约信息

区块链能够记录合约和智能合约的执行代码以及过程状态等信息,智能合约是一种自动执行的合约,当满足特定条件时,合约将自动执行预设的操作,区块链上的智能合约信息包括合约标识、合约版本号、合约代码、合约状态等,这些信息都被永久地存储在区块链上,无法被篡改。

五、其他有价值的信息

除了上述信息外,区块链还可以记录几乎所有对人类有价值的事物,出生和死亡证明、财务账户、就医历史、保险理赔单、食品来源以及任何其他可以用代码表示的事物,这些信息都可以通过区块链的分布式账本进行记录和验证,从而提高信息的真实性和可信度。

六、区块链数据的具体分类

从技术的角度来看,区块链上的数据还可以进一步细分为以下几类:

1、配置数据:记录区块链系统各节点的配置信息,包括系统软件版本号、共识协议版本号、节点标识和节点地址等数据元。

2、账户数据:记录区块链系统事务关联的账户信息,包括账户所属机构、账户公钥、账户私钥、账户资产、数字证书等数据元。

3、区块数据:区块链网络的底层链式数据,用来把一段给定时间内发生的事务处理结果持久化为成块链式数据结构。

4、事务数据:描述区块链系统上承载的具体业务动作的数据,既包括交易类型事务,也包括非交易类型事务。

5、实体数据:描述事务的静态属性的数据,包括发起方标识、接收方标识、自定义业务数据等数据元。

6、合约数据:记录区块链合约的执行代码以及过程状态等信息。

区块链能够记录的信息种类繁多,涵盖了交易、身份和权属、公共管理、合约以及其他有价值的信息等多个方面,这些信息的记录和验证都通过区块链的分布式账本实现,确保了信息的真实性和可信度。